Hi, Hope someone can help...

This is the set up:

An inventel wireless livebox (Model DV4210-WU) connected to internet
and providing wireless access to users. (On IP 192.168.1.1) set to
DHCP.

A netgear wireless printserver (USB) and 4 port switch (Model WGPS606)
placed far enough away to still be able to connect to the inventel
livebox. (On 192.168.1.102) set as manual IP.

Then a D-Link 301P+ Ethernet Printer Server on (IP 192.168.1.15)
connected to a Laserjet 5P.

Right the situation is this: we want to be able to print from any
wireless computer to the HP printer. So far this has been done:

The netgear switch connects to the Inventel box (However dont see
associated devices on the Inventel box) The D-link print server when
connected to PC is fine and can ping it. However when I connect it to
one of the LAN ports on the netgear switch I cant find it any more.

I have removed firewalls, we are currently runing XP

Thanks for any help
